Company Overview

Calix,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of cloud and software platforms, and systems and services in the United States, rest of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. Its cloud and software platforms, and systems and services enable broadband service providers (BSPs) to provide a range of services. The company provides Calix Cloud platform, a role-based analytics platform comprising Calix Engagement Cloud, Calix Service Cloud, and Calix Operations Cloud, which are configurable to display role-based insights and enable BSPs to anticipate and target new revenue-generating services and applications through mobile application, such as CommandIQ for residents and CommandWorx for businesses; Calix Intelligent Access EDGE, an access network solution for automated and intelligent networks; and Calix Revenue EDGE, a premises solution for subscriber managed services. It also offers SmartLife managed services, including SmartHome managed services and applications to enhance, operate and secure the connected experience of subscribers in their home; SmartTown managed services that reimagine community Wi-Fi as a ubiquitous, secure, and managed experience across a BSP's footprint; and SmartBiz managed services that address the business networking and productivity needs of business owners with an all-in-one managed service. In addition, the company provides Wi-Fi systems under GigaSpire and GigaPro brands to be ready for deployment as a complete subscriber experience solution for BSP's residential and business subscribers. It offers its products through its direct sales force and resellers. The company was incorporated in 1999 and is headquartered in San Jose, California.

Calix, Inc. (NYSE:CALX) released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, January, 29th. The communications equipment provider reported ($0.24) E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.07 by $0.31. Calix had a negative trailing twelve-month return on equity of 3.43% and a negative net margin of 3.58%.

The following companies are subsidiaries of Calix: Occam Networks Inc., Optical Solutions Inc., Calix Brasil Servicos Ltda., Calix International Inc., Calix Networks UK Ltd., Calix Network Technology Development (Nanjing) Co. Ltd., and CIDC Private Limited.

Top institutional shareholders of Calix include Vanguard Group Inc. (12.03%), Alliancebernstein L.P. (3.38%), Millennium Management LLC (3.06%) and Dimensional Fund Advisors LP (2.76%). Insiders that own company stock include Carl Russo, Donald J Listwin, Kevin A Denuccio, Cory Sindelar, Michael Matthews, Kathleen M Crusco, Kira Makagon and John Matthew Collins.
